Kaizer Chiefs might have to up the ante if they are indeed chasing Sibusiso ‘Vila’ Vilakazi. Reports say SuperSport United and AmaZulu are also interested in the 32-year-old attacking midfielder.

SUPERSPORT UNITED AND AMAZULU BATTLING KAIZER CHIEFS FOR VILAKAZI?

As previously reported by The South African, Vilakazi is a target at Naturena. New reports now say that SuperSport have also mentioned the player’s name in their offices, as well as Durban giants AmaZulu.

Kaizer Chiefs and SuperSport United are likely to be joined by AmaZulu FC in their pursuit of Sibusiso Vilakazi from Mamelodi Sundowns,” Soccer Laduma reported in their recent issue.

As reported by the Siya crew in December, Chiefs had made informal enquiries into the Sundowns attacker’s availability, with the player’s future at Chloorkop increasingly in doubt due to his regular lack of game time,” the outlet added.

“SuperSport subsequently entered into the mix, with sources indicating last month that the club was considering bringing him on board.

“The latest news reaching the Siya crew is that AmaZulu are admirers of the 32-year-old, and according to sources, Vilakazi has been identified as a possible replacement for Siyethemba Sithebe, who will be leaving the Durban-based club to join Chiefs at the end of the season after signing a pre-contract with them,” the report added.

The report concluded by confirming a major obstacle. The Meadowlands-born player is still contracted to Sundowns until 2024. This means that negotiations for a transfer fee will need to be agreed on and paid.
